This project entails training 172 new directors annually from all TRIO programs. The training provides a variety of professional development opportunities focusing on general project management, specifically compliance with the statutory regulations, reporting student and project performance, evaluation, record keeping, budget management, participant retention, assisting students in receiving financial aid, postsecondary admissions, developing financial and economic literacy in students, recruiting and serving hard-to-reach participants, improving institutional relations, and new management and student learning technologies. TRIO Training grants assist in gaining national exposure for SSU and its academic programs. A majority of the participants in these grants function as high school and community college counselors to hundreds of thousands of low-income, first-generation students who are trained to become successful college students. Many of these students have full-ride scholarships and are using these professionals to determine where to attend college. This brings the potential for highly diverse out of state recruitment that would otherwise not exist. These programs also bring the name of Sonoma State University to the forefront within the U.S. Department of Education and are known for high quality training programs that have lasted over ten years.
